She gathered them at eight. Not formally — she didn't send announcements or schedule the thing with the precision of a managed event. She went from room to room, person to person, the way she went about most things: directly, simply, in the specific grammar of the house. Jax was in the kitchen finishing the washing up. She stood in the doorway and said: "Sitting room at eight. The fourth phase." He looked at her over his shoulder and said: "Yes." No questions. No qualifications. Just: yes. Cade was in the library — Petra had gone to her room for the evening and he'd stayed in the library, which she'd expected, because Cade in the evenings needed the books the way other people needed sleep.
